What is the PM Kisan Scheme?
The PM Kisan Samman Nidhi Yojana, which was introduced in February 2019, gives qualified farmers Rs 6,000 a year in three equal installments of Rs 2,000 each. Through the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) mechanism, the money is sent straight to the bank accounts of beneficiaries.

Which farmers may not receive the next installment?
The department has identified certain suspected cases that may fall under the exclusion criteria outlined in the PM-KISAN scheme guidelines. These include, for example, farmers who acquired land ownership after February 1, 2019, and cases where more than one family member is receiving benefits (such as both husband and wife, or an adult and a minor). The benefits for such cases have been temporarily withheld until physical verification is completed.

Farmers are advised to check their eligibility status through the "Know Your Status (KYS)" feature on the PM-KISAN website, mobile app, or the Kisan eMitra chatbot for further details.

PM Kisan 21 installment date
The 20th installment of PM Kisan was released in August 2025, credited directly to the accounts of more than 8.5 crore farmers. The next installment is likely to be disbursed in November, 2025.

How farmers can check their beneficiary status
Step 1: Visit the official PM Kisan Website.
Step 2: Access the Beneficiary Status Page.
Step 3: Click on "Beneficiary Status"
Step 4: Enter your Aadhaar Number or Account Number.
Step 5: Click on "Get Data"
Step 6: View Beneficiary Status.
Step 7: Check for Payment Status.
Your beneficiary status will be shown on the screen when the system processes your request and checks the PM Kisan database for your details.

Which states have already received the 21st installment of PM-Kisan?
The 21st installment of the PM-Kisan scheme has been specially transferred to the accounts of the farmers of Himachal Pradesh, Punjab, and Uttarakhand as these states witnessed severe floods and landslides in September 2025. The 21st installment of the PM-Kisan scheme was also disbursed to Jammu and Kashmir on October 7, 2025.
